What the data shows

Ringwood saw somewhat more crime than Bisley in February 2026 (71 vs 59 incidents). The crime profiles diverge meaningfully: Bisley sees higher rates of Other crime (14) and Shoplifting (10), while Ringwood has more Anti-social behaviour (11) and Criminal damage & arson (8). Both areas sit below the national average for recorded crime — a positive sign for either location.
